A hit-and-run suspect is now behind bars after an incident sent a bicyclist to the hospital, according to the Richland Police Department.

Driver Accused in Richland Bicycle Hit-and-Run Now Facing Charges

In a report on a Facebook posting from the Richland Police Department (RPD), officers were dispatched to a vehicle versus bicycle hit-and-run collision at Duportail Street and Keene Road on March 27, 2026, at 12:00 PM.

Richland Police Find Driver After Bicycle Crash on Keene Road

Here's the incident as filed by the Richland Police Department:

 

Officers arrived and learned that a large box truck had been driving south on Keene Road when it attempted to make a left turn onto Duportail St.

The truck was reportedly traveling at a high rate of speed and ran up onto the sidewalk, hitting the bicyclist.

The adult female bicyclist was transported by ambulance to an area hospital where we gratefully learned she had only minor injuries.

After a thorough investigation, the truck was located, and the driver was eventually identified.

He now faces charges of reckless driving, driving with a suspended license, and failing to stop and identify himself at a collision that caused injuries.

Again, if you cause an accident, it's always best to stay at the scene and wait for the police.
